T-Mobile’s Sidekick 3 is alive and kicking

by Adam Berger on Jun 20, 2006 at 04:16 PM

Sidekick 3

Engadget is reporting that T-Mobile and Danger (the makers of the Sidekick) are going to be officially announcing the new, highly anticipated Sidekick 3—not Sidekick III, they were very clear about that. The tri-band GSM/GPRS/EDGE model will measure in at 130 x 59 x 21.8mm and weigh in at 6.7 ounces. IT has a 240 x 160 pixel, 65,000 color display, trackball, is Bluetooth 1.2 capable, has a 1.3 megapixel digital camera w/LED flash, miniSD memory card slot (supports up to 2GB), has 64MB of SDRAM/64MB Flash internal memory, and includes music player software.

Overall this seems to be a general improvement over the previous model. Danger has gone ahead and added expected functions and features such as a better camera, Bluetooth 1.2, and lightened the load. The trackball seems like a nice surprise, but we have not received any hands on impression yet so that is still tbd.
